Debian(amd64)でdriverをコンパイルに失敗する
DebianでPT1のドライバをコンパイルしようとしたところ、
make[1]: ディレクトリ `/lib/modules/2.6.26-2-amd64/build' に入ります
make[1]: *** ターゲット `modules' を make するルールがありません。中止
make[1]: ディレクトリから `/lib/modules/2.6.26-2-amd64/build' 出ます
make" ***[pt1_drv.ko] エラー 2
となりドライバが作成できません。
調べたところmakeに失敗するのは下記がバージョンがずれているときと出ていましたがこれ以上は疎くわかりません。
dpkg -l | grep linux-source
ii linux-source-2.6.26 2.6.26-24lenny1
dpkg -l | grep linux-headers
ii linux-headers-2.6.26-2-amd64 2.6.26-24lenny1
ii linux-headers-2.6.26-2-common 2.6.26-24lenny1
A 回答 (4件)
- 最新から表示
- 回答順に表示
No.4
- 回答日時:
No.3 さんでよいと思うが
下記で、errorは起きなかった。
-rw-r--r-- 1 root root 48950 2010-08-24 21:23 pt1_drv.ko
が生成出来た。
dpkg -l | grep linux-source
dpkg -l | grep linux-headers
の結果が微妙に違うのだが
uname -a
2.6.26-2-amd64 #1 SMP Sun Jun 20 20:16:30 UTC 2010 x86_64 GNU/Linux
lsb_release -a
LSB Version:core-2.0-amd64:core-2.0-noarch:core-3.0-amd64:core-3.0-noarch:core-3.1-amd64:core-3.1-noarch:core-3.2-amd64:core-3.2-noarch:cxx-3.0-amd64:cxx-3.0-noarch:cxx-3.1-amd64:cxx-3.1-noarch:cxx-3.2-amd64:cxx-3.2-noarch:desktop-3.1-amd64:desktop-3.1-noarch:desktop-3.2-amd64:desktop-3.2-noarch:graphics-2.0-amd64:graphics-2.0-noarch:graphics-3.0-amd64:graphics-3.0-noarch:graphics-3.1-amd64:graphics-3.1-noarch:graphics-3.2-amd64:graphics-3.2-noarch:qt4-3.1-amd64:qt4-3.1-noarch
Distributor ID:Debian
Description:Debian GNU/Linux 5.0.5 (lenny)
Release:5.0.5
Codename:lenny
No.3
- 回答日時:
ソースはこの際関係ありません。
ヘッダとuname -aで表示されるカーネルのバージョンとが一致するかどうかを確認しましょう。一致しなかったら両方ともaptでアップグレードするなりしてバージョンを合わせてからリトライ。
No.2
- 回答日時:
そのサイトを個人的に利用するtomy氏が自分の環境用に試験的に作成されたソースコードを置いているだけのもののようですね。
ソースを解析し、どのような環境でもコンパイルできるものに仕上げてtomy氏に連絡を差し上げれば、tomy氏も喜ぶとおもいますよ。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- その他(ソフトウェア) Makefileが実行できない 2 2022/07/28 23:49
- モニター・ディスプレイ DisplayPort 入力のMSTハブ(Linux対応)を探しています。 Linux を2画面で作 1 2022/11/07 21:10
- UNIX・Linux DisplayPort 入力のMSTハブ(Linux対応)を探しています。 Linux を2画面で作 1 2022/11/07 20:48
- PostgreSQL PostgreSQL14.6のSSL対応について 1 2023/01/05 15:42
- UNIX・Linux Linuxのbash環境下です。 1 2022/11/27 12:31
- UNIX・Linux swapが機能しているかの確認について 2 2022/09/18 13:17
- UNIX・Linux サーバー間のデータコピー(データ形式とデーターフォーマットの変換あり。一定間隔で処理) 2 2023/08/22 22:15
- 英語 to不定詞は、to不定詞を目的語にできますか? 1 2022/05/11 14:36
- オープンソース stable diffusionのインストールがうまくいきません。 1 2023/06/20 13:09
- 英語 提示文の構造について 3 2022/06/27 18:03
このQ&Aを見た人はこんなQ&Aも見ています
関連するカテゴリからQ&Aを探す
おすすめ情報
このQ&Aを見た人がよく見るQ&A
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
ubuntu(linux)のシャットダウン...
-
ubuntuのサーバー(virtual box)...
-
Ubuntu on Xorgのログインについて
-
ubuntuで デイスク/deb/loopと...
-
AWSでSSH接続をしたいのですが...
-
Linux Ubuntu22.4の起動時エラ...
-
Linux Mint 日本語入力できなく...
-
ChromebookでPythonを使いたい...
-
Linux Mint でも使えないですよ...
-
Windowsのローカルディレクトリ...
-
Ubuntuサーバーでメールを受信...
-
AppImageがインストールできな...
-
Kali Linuxで起動できない - Mi...
-
ノートPCでUSBから起動しない
-
ssl_error_logのエラー内容(AH...
-
ssl_request_logの必要性について
-
古いiMacにLinuxをインストール...
-
Let’s Encrypt の自動更新をcro...
-
windows10を使っています。 wsl...
-
Linux のシェルスクリプトの強...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
Debian(amd64)でdriverをコンパ...
-
mac osの見た目はlinuxに似てい...
-
reboot( RB_POWER_OFF )が上手...
-
cygwin上でemacsの終了ができない
-
RedHat7.3とRedHat8.0の違い
-
VineLinuxにDualCPUを認識させ...
-
windows10の再インストールがで...
-
スライドショー(速度)について
-
WinSCPをフォルダに入れる方法...
-
Apple Vision Pro に “DMM VR動...
-
dell ノートパソコン 起動しな...
-
「Volumes」というフィルダにつ...
-
Apple PayのICOCAについて
-
office2010とoffice365の共存で...
-
Active X をインストール済かど...
-
ディスクのクローン作成
-
pcの再起動を邪魔するものの正...
-
jucheck.exe とは何ですか。
-
Microsoft Officeを2台目のPCに...
-
BIOSループ
おすすめ情報